Osteochondrosis of the spine

Osteochondrosis of the spine is a chronic disease in which degenerative changes in the vertebrae and the intervertebral discs located.According to the place of damage to the spine, they distinguish: osteochondrosis in the cervical region, osteochondrosis in the chest region and osteochondrosis in the lumbar region.To diagnose osteochondrosis of the spine, it is necessary to carry out radiography, and in the case of its complications (for example, an herniated of the intervertebral disc) - MRI of the spine.In the treatment of osteochondrosis of the spine, as well as medication methods, it is widely used, reflexology, massage, manual therapy, physiotherapy and physiotherapy exercises.

Etiology and pathogenesis

To one degree or another, osteochondrosis of the spine develops in all the elderly and is one of the body's aging process.Earlier or later, atrophic changes occur in the intervertebral disc, however, injuries, diseases and various spine overloads contribute to the anterior occurrence of osteochondrosis.The most common osteochondrosis in the cervical region and osteochondrosis in the lumbar column.

About 10 theories of osteochondrosis have been developed: vascular, hormonal, mechanical, hereditary, infectious-allergic and others.But none of them gives a complete explanation of the changes that occur in the spine, they are rather complementary to each other.

It is believed that the main point of the occurrence of osteochondrosis is the constant overload of the vertebral engine composed of two adjacent vertebrae.Such an overload can occur following an engine stereotype - posture, in an individual way of sitting and walking.The poster disorders, seated in poor pose, walking with an uneven spine cause an additional load on the discs, ligaments and muscles of the spine.The process can worsen due to the characteristics of the spine structure and the insufficiency of its tissue trophism due to hereditary factors.Most often, the vices of the structure are in the cervical region and lead to vascular disorders and to the early appearance of signs of osteochondrosis of the cervical column.

The occurrence of osteochondrosis in the lumbar region is more often associated with its overload during the inclinations and elevators of gravity.A healthy intervertebral disc can withstand significant loads due to the hydrophilia of the pulpoose nucleus located in its center.The nucleus contains a large amount of water and fluids, as you know, are not very compressed.The degradation of a healthy intervertebral disc can occur with a compression of more than 500 kg, while the disc has changed due to osteochondosis is torn with a compression of 200 kg.A 200 kg load experiences a lumbar from the spine of a person weighing 70 kg, when she maintains a 15 -kilograms cargo in the body's inclination position before 200. Such pressure is due to the low size of the pulp nucleus.With an increase in inclination to 700, the load on the intervertebral discs will be 489 kg.Consequently, often the first clinical manifestations of osteochondrosis in the lumbar column occur during or after the weight lifting, carrying out housework, weeding in the garden, etc.

The destruction of the connective tissue of the fibrous ring of the disc, ligaments and capsules of the facets of facets causes the reaction of the immune system and the development of aseptic inflammation with the swelling of the facets and their surrounding tissues.Due to the displacement of vertebral bodies, the faceted joint capsules are stretched and the altered intervertebral disc is not so firmly fixed by the bodies of the neighboring vertebrae.The instability of the vertebral segment is formed.Due to instability, violation of the vertebral nerve with the development of a radicular syndrome is possible.With osteochondrosis of the cervical column, this often happens during the turns of the head, with osteochondrosis in the lumbar region - during the inclinations of the body.It is possible to form a functional block of the vertebral engine segment.This is due to the reduction in compensation for vertebral muscles.

The hernia of the intervertebral disc forms when the disc retires, the rupture of the posterior longitudinal ligament and the projection of the disc in the vertebral channel occur.If at the same time the core of the disc is pressed in the cerebrospinal canal, then such a hernia is called explosion.The severity and duration of the pain with such hernia are much greater than with unploded.The hernia of the disc can cause radicular syndrome or compression of the spinal cord.

With osteochondrosis, the growth of bone tissue occurs with the formation of osteophytes - bone growths on the bodies and processes of the vertebrae.Osteophytes can also cause compression of the spinal cord or cause the development of root syndrome.

Symptoms of osteochondrosis of the spine

The main symptom of osteochondrosis in the spine is pain.The pain can be acute with high intensity, it intensifies with the slightest movement in the affected segment and therefore takes the patient to take a forced position.Thus, with the osteochondrosis of the cervical column, the patient holds his head in the least painful installation and cannot turn it, with osteochondrosis in the thoracic region, pain even increases with deep breathing, and with osteochondrosis of the lumbar region, it is difficult to sit, climb and walk.Such a pain syndrome is characteristic of compression of the spine column.

In about 80% of cases, there is dull pain of a constant nature and moderate intensity.In such cases, during the examination, the doctor must differentiate the manifestations of osteochondrosis from the spine of the myositis of the back muscles.Mute pain in osteochondrosis is due to excessive muscle tension, now the affected vertebral engine segment, inflammatory changes or significant stretch of the intervertebral disc.In patients with such pain, a forced position is absent, but the restriction of movements and physical activity is revealed.Patients with the cervical column osteochondrosis avoid the turns and sharp inclinations with the head, with osteochondrosis in the lumbar region - sit slowly and get up, avoid tilt of the body.

Complications of osteochondrosis of the spine

The complications of osteochondrosis are associated with the hernia of the intervertebral disc.These include the compression of the spinal cord, which is characterized by numbness, the weakness of certain muscle groups of the extremities (depending on the level of compression), leading to the appearance of paresis, muscle atrophy, a change in the reflexes of the tendon, mation and defecation.The intervertebral hernia can cause compression of the artery supplying the spinal cord with the formation of ischemic zones (infarction of the spinal cord) with the death of the nerve cells.This is manifested by the appearance of a neurological deficit (altered movements, sensitivity, trophic disorders) corresponding to the level and the prevalence of ischemia.

Diagnosis of spine osteochondrosis

The diagnosis of vertebral osteochondosis is made by a neurologist or a vertebrologist.At the initial stage, the radiography of the spine is carried out in 2 projections.If necessary, they can draw a separate vertebral segment and pull in additional projections.For the diagnosis of intervertebral hernias, the evaluation of the spinal cord state and detect complications of osteochondrosis, magnetic tomography and resonance (MRI of the spine) is used.An important role is played by MRI in the differential diagnosis of osteochondrosis and other vertebral diseases: spondylitis of tuberculosis, osteomyelitis, tumors, ankylosing spondel, rheumatism, infectious lesions.Sometimes, in case of complicated osteochondrosis of the cervical column, the exclusion of syringomyelia is necessary.In some cases, if the MRI is impossible, the myelography is shown.

A targeted study of the affected intervertebral disc is possible using discography.Electrophysiological studies are used to determine the degree and location of nerve road damage, to monitor the process of their restoration during treatment.

Treatment of spine osteochondrosis

During the acute period, peace is indicated in the assigned vertebral engine segment.To this end, with the osteochondrosis of the cervical column, the fixing is used using a Chantz necklace, with osteochondrosis in the lumbar region - rest in bed.A fixation is also necessary for osteochondrosis in the cervical region with the instability of the vertebral segment.

In the pharmacotherapy of osteochondrosis, non-steroidal anti-inflammatory drugs (NSAIDs) are used: diclofenac, nimesulide, lornoxicam, melooxicam.With intense pain syndrome, pain relievers are represented, for example, an analgesic central action of fluctortine.To relieve muscle tension, muscle relaxants are used - tolperisone, thizanidine.In some cases, it is advisable to prescribe anticonvulsants - carbamazepine, gabapentine drugs;Antidepressants, among which preference is given to inhibitors of the opposite capture of serotonin (Cerseralin, paroxetine).

In the event of a radicular syndrome, hospital treatment is indicated.Glucocorticoids are possible to be introduced, treatment against edema, use of traction.In the treatment of osteochondrosis, physiotherapy, reflexology, massage, physiotherapy exercises are widely used.The use of manual therapy requires clear observation of the technique of its implementation and special caution in the treatment of osteochondrosis of the cervical column.

The spine operations are indicated mainly with a significant compression of the spinal cord.It consists in eliminating the hernia of the intervertebral disc and the decompression of the vertebral canal.It is possible to perform a microdissectomy, the laser reconstruction of the disc, the replacement of the disc affected by an implant, the stabilization of the vertebral segment.
